电脑技术学习

自制Chrome浏览器免安装绿色版方法

dn001

  今天安装了谷歌浏览器(Google Chrome),才发现绿化它还不是复制、粘贴就可以的,还要设置一下才行。下面是看到的比较有用资料。不过按部就班的话操作好像麻烦了点,其实最重要的一步就是将相应版本的文件和文件夹复制到跟 chrome.exe 同一目录下就可以了。

  不加参数运行,Chorme 的配置文件会自动存放在 :C:Documents and Settings你的用户名Local SettingsApplication DataGoogleChrome 当然,如果你想要将个人设置文件也同步就加上相应指定设置文件路径的运行参数。
如果你想把复制到非系统盘,或者USB闪存盘,然后配置文件也随chrome.exe主程序一起,怎么办呢?通过秘密命令行参数可以实现!免安装,即拷即用。
把chrome从系统目录提取出来
Vista下,Win+R运行 C:Users你的用户名AppDataLocalGoogleChrome
XP下,Win+R运行 C:Documents and Settings你的用户名Local SettingsApplication DataGoogleChrome
然后把application文件夹复制出来,把文件夹改名为“est的谷歌浏览器”之类的。然后进入这个文件夹,新建一个文件夹,名字叫做est_profile
最后把0.2.149.27目录下的所有文件、文件夹移动到chrome.exe同级目录下。
在chrome.exe目录初始化配置文件
然后Win+R打开命令行,cd 到你复制出来的chrome.exe所在路径,运行
chrome.exe --first-run --user-data-dir=est_profile
好了。Google Chrome已经在当前目录下的est_profile初始化用户配置文件完毕了。
建立快捷方式
为了方便随时打开绿色版的 Google Chrome,现在桌面建立个chrome.exe的快捷方式;右击这个快捷方式,属性,在“目标”后面添加
--user-data-dir=est_profile
注意添加的命令行启动参数最前面有个空格。完整路径例子:
D:SoftwareChromechrome.exe --user-data-dir=est_profile
进一步定制可以用的参数
--single-process 单进程运行Google Chrome
--start-maximized 启动Google Chrome就最大化
--disable-java 禁止Java(Google Chrome的第二个安全漏洞就是Java的,真可恶!严格的说这是老版本的webkit引起的。)
Google Chrome的精简
Chrome目录下(原来0.2.149.27目录下的)
Installer子目录可以直接删除掉
Locales下面只保留en-US.dll和zh-CN.dll就可以了
这样精简下来Google Chrome总大小是21.8 MB,比默认的46.5 MB少了很多。如果WinRAR一下,只有7.5MB。